(图片来源网络,侵删)
LINUX是一套免费使用和自由传播的类UNIX操作系统,是一个基于POSIX和UNIX的多用户、多任务、支持多线程和多CPU的操作系统。CentOS是一种以企业级应用为目标的Linux发行版,被广泛应用于服务器领域。MySQL是一种开源的关系型数据库管理系统,被广泛应用于各种Web应用开发中。
在CentOS下使用MySQL进行数据库管理时,经常需要导入和导出SQL文件。本文将详细介绍如何在CentOS下使用MySQL进行SQL文件的导入和导出操作。
(图片来源网络,侵删)
在CentOS下使用MySQL导出SQL文件的命令是mysqldump。使用mysqldump命令可以导出整个数据库或指定的表。以下是使用mysqldump命令导出SQL文件的示例:
```
(图片来源网络,侵删)
$ mysqldump -u 用户名 -p 密码 数据库名 > 导出的文件名.sql
-u选项指定要连接的MySQL服务器的用户名,-p选项指定密码,数据库名为要导出的数据库名称,>导出的文件名.sql为导出的SQL文件的保存路径和文件名。
要导出名为test的数据库,可以使用以下命令:
$ mysqldump -u root -p test > /home/user/test.sql
导出的SQL文件将保存在/home/user/目录下,并命名为test.sql。
在CentOS下使用MySQL导入SQL文件的命令是mysql。使用mysql命令可以将SQL文件中的数据导入到指定的数据库中。以下是使用mysql命令导入SQL文件的示例:
$ mysql -u 用户名 -p 密码 数据库名
-u选项指定要连接的MySQL服务器的用户名,-p选项指定密码,数据库名为要导入的数据库名称,
要将test.sql文件中的数据导入到名为test的数据库中,可以使用以下命令:
$ mysql -u root -p test
导入操作将会将test.sql文件中的数据导入到test数据库中。
本文介绍了在CentOS下使用MySQL导入和导出SQL文件的命令。通过使用mysqldump命令和mysql命令,可以方便地进行数据库的备份和恢复操作。在实际应用中,我们可以根据需要定期备份数据库,以防止数据丢失。
LINUX为您分享一个Ubuntu小知识:
在Ubuntu中,您可以使用Ctrl+Alt+T快捷键打开终端。终端是Ubuntu中非常强大的工具,可以方便地执行各种命令和操作系统任务。使用终端可以更加高效地管理和操作Ubuntu系统。